The 3-day MoR Foundation Course covers the principles, the approach and the processes of managing risk at the strategic, programme, project and operational level, and how to embed and review risk management within an organisation, as described in the MoR guide.
Participants are provided with an annotated hard copy of the slides together with any exercises, examples and templates discussed or developed during the workshop, as well as a copy of the official Guide “Management of Risk: Guidance for Practitioners”, and a mock foundation exam paper.

Pre-Requisites
There are no pre requisites to sit the Foundation exam.
Examination
The purpose of the foundation certification is to confirm that a candidate is able to demonstrate a knowledge and comprehension of the four elements of the MoR framework - Principles, Approach, Processes, Embedding and reviewing - and how they support corporate governance.
The Foundation level is also a pre-requisite for the Practitioner qualification.
Exam Format
- Multiple choice
- 75 questions per paper
- 5 questions to be trial and not counted in scores
- 35 marks required to pass (out of 70 available) - 50%
- 60 minutes duration
- Closed book.
